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

Summe ohne #NV Werte über 3 Tabellenblätter
#1
Question 
Mein Problem:
Ich habe in einzelnen Tabellenblättern (Tabelle 1, Tabelle 2, Tabelle 3) über eine WENN-Funktion aus einer dritten Datei Werte gezogen, ansonsten soll er #NV schreiben und die Zelle bleibt leer.

=WENN('C:\Users\xx\[Rohdaten Test.xlsx]test'!E1347=0;#NV; 'C:\Users\xx\[Rohdaten Test.xlsx]test'!E1347)

Jetzt soll in einer 4.Tabelle (TOTAL) eine Summe der 3 Tabellenblätter gezeigt werden. Also eigentlich eine simple Summenformel der einzelnen Felder.
Dadurch, dass in Tabelle 2 und Tabelle 3 aber kein Wert steht, bringt er nur die Fehlermeldung #WERT.
Wenn ich google find ich Lösungsansätze – aber nur innerhalb einer Tabelle, für meine Summe über 3 Tabellenblätter funktionieren sie nicht – oder besser gesagt ich hab’s nicht gepackt.
 
Hat jemand eine Idee? Originaldatei kann ich leider nicht einbinden, hoffe ich konnte es verständlich erklären

   

Schon mal vielen Dank im Vorraus für die Tipps!
(OFFICE 2016)
Antworten Top
#2
Hi,

schau dir mal die Fkt. AGGREGAT an.
Gruß Günter
Jeder Fehler erscheint unglaublich dumm, wenn andere ihn begehen.
angebl. von Georg Christoph Lichtenberg (1742-1799)
Antworten Top
#3
Liest sich gut.
Aber wie muss ich die 3 Felder der Tabellenblätter eingeben (Matrix).

Bin nicht so fit bei den Funktionen Sad
Antworten Top
#4
Hab's grad geschafft.
VIEEEEELEN Dank für deine Hilfe !!!!!!!!!!!!
Unbezahlbar das Forum für so Nieten wie mich Wink
Antworten Top
#5
Hi,

Code:
=AGGREGAT(9;6;Tabelle1!A1;Tabelle2!A1;Tabelle3!A1)

die Bereiche musst du auf deine Gegebenheiten anpassen.
Gruß Günter
Jeder Fehler erscheint unglaublich dumm, wenn andere ihn begehen.
angebl. von Georg Christoph Lichtenberg (1742-1799)
Antworten Top
#6
Hinterfragenswert ist, ob man Fehler wegAGGREGIERT oder sie lieber bewusst als Warnung belässt, damit man sie schon an der Quelle korrigiert!

Ich habe lieber die Fehler, damit ich mein Modell über alle Ebenen sauber halten kann.
Antworten Top
#7
Hallo lupo1,

in diesem thread ist die Eingangsfragestellung wohl etwas verwirrend und somit mE nur diese "hinterfragenswert".  Denn wenn ein Summanden wirklich einen Fehlerwert #NV haben sollte (welches seine Formelangabe suggeriert), ist die Summierung mit AGGREGAT();9;6;.... )  sogar notwendig, weil anderenfalls das gewünschte Ergebnis ja nicht bzw. nur umständlicher erzielt werden kann.

Allerdings schreibt F71 auch etwas davon, dass ein zu summierender Zellwert  "leer" sein könnte. Damit meint er wahrscheinlich ="", denn darauf deutet auch seine Angabe hin, wonach bei seiner Summierung ein WERT#! -Fehlermeldung entstanden wäre.

Wenn in den Summanden aber nur Zahlenwerte und/oder="" vorkommen können, bräuchte er AGGREGAT() wirklich nicht. Denn dann wäre es ausreichend, anstelle die 3 Summanden durch den Operator + zu verknüpfen einfach nur =SUMME(...;...;...)  zu schreiben.
Gruß Werner
.. , - ...
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ste